Ans. C: Odd's ratio can be calculated Coho study is often undeaken to obtain evidence to try to refute the existence of a suspected association between cause and effect. Crucially, the coho is identified before the appearance of the disease under investigation. The study groups, so defined, are observed over a period of time to determine the frequency of new incidence of the studied disease among them. The coho cannot therefore be defined as a group of people who already have the disease. Coho studies can either be performed prospectively or retrospectively from historical records. Prospective (longitudinal) coho studies between exposure and disease strongly aid in studying causal associations. The advantage of prospective coho study data is the longitudinal observation of the individual through time, and the collection of data at regular intervals, so recall error is reduced. However, coho studies are expensive to conduct, are sensitive to attrition and take a long follow-up time to generate useful data. Neveheless, the results that are obtained from long-term coho studies are of substantially superior quality to retrospective/cross-sectional studies, and coho studies are considered the gold standard in observational epidemiology. Moreover, coho studies are informative for efficiently studying a wide-range of exposure-disease associations. It is the most reliable mean of showing an association between a suspected risk factor and subsequent disease because it eliminates many of the problems of the case control study. Odd's ratio can be derived from a case control study, which is a measure of the strength of the association between risk factor and outcome.
